I stared at the privacy partition separating us from the driver, my hands tightly clasped in my lap. Kain’s vow to my grandmother still echoed in my ears. In my world, there are no rules, only Adelina. It was a beautiful, terrifying declaration. And I didn’t believe a word of it.
“You don’t have to perform when it’s just the two of us,” I said quietly, breaking the heavy silence.
Kain shifted beside me, his massive frame taking up too much space. “Perform p>
“What you said to Maeve,” I clarified, forcing myself to meet his storm-gray eyes. “It was a brilliant lie, Kain. It secures her trust and solidifies your control over my Pack. But I know what this is. I was Jase’s stepping stone for years. I know my place p>
The temperature in the car seemed to plummet. Kain’s jaw tightened, a dangerous muscle ticking near his ear.
“I am a wolfless Omega,” I pushed forward, ignoring the warning rumble vibrating in his chest. My insecurities, honed by years of abuse, demanded I protect myself from hoping for more. “A Lycan King doesn’t respect a wolfless Omega. He manages her like an asset. A political transaction for my White Wolf bloodline p>
For a fraction of a second, his eyes bled into pitch-black. The sheer frustration rolling off him was so intense it made my skin prickle. He leaned in, his voice a low, lethal rasp. “You are infuriating, Adelina p>
He didn’t defend himself. He didn’t deny it. He simply pulled back, the impenetrable mask of the Lycan King slamming back into place. “Tomorrow morning, we deal with the traitors in your Pack. Try to remember you are my Queen, not a ledger entry p>
The rest of the ride passed in a suffocating, unresolved silence.
Hours later, the tension still gnawed at my chest as I lay in the Master Den at Blackstone Tower, staring at the white ceiling. The small blue Tiffany box rested on the mattress beside me. I had bought it earlier, telling myself it was just a prop to make our upcoming Pack dinner look authentic — but deep down, it was a desperate attempt to find some balance, a silent thank you to the man who had terrified Jase Davenport into submission.
Gathering my courage, I grabbed the box and walked down the hall to Kain’s temporary quarters.

The door was slightly ajar. Golden light spilled into the corridor. I pushed it open and froze.
Kain was standing over a massive obsidian desk, surrounded by blueprints stamped with Wolfe Hotel Expansion Phase 1. He was shirtless. His broad, heavily muscled back was a landscape of faded battle scars, but as he turned to face me, all the air left my lungs.
Right over his heart, inked in jagged, ancient script, were the letters A.W.
My heart plummeted into my stomach. Because I was wolfless, I felt no hum of magic, no mate-bond pull to that ink. My logic, poisoned by Jase’s betrayals, instantly filled the void.
A.W.
Another woman. A lost Fated Mate. It confirmed my deepest, darkest fear. I wasn’t special. I was just a convenient White Wolf replacement he could dress up in her initials.
“Adelina?” Kain asked, his brow furrowing as he noticed my pale face.
